AFLAC President and CFO Cloninger Joins TSYS Board.


COLUMBUS, Ga. -- Kriss Cloninger III, president and chief financial officer of AFLAC Inc., was elected to the TSYS board of directors on July 20. His term begins immediately, and he will stand for re-election by TSYS shareholders at the next annual meeting of shareholders in April 2005.

"Based on his contributions to AFLAC's enviable history of shareholder returns and experience in Asian markets, Kriss is a wonderful addition to our board of directors as TSYS continues its record of growth and international expansion," says Richard W. Ussery, chairman of the board of TSYS. "As CFO See Chief Financial Officer.  of one of America's most respected and admired companies, Kriss has a tremendous grasp of issues related to sound corporate governance."

Cloninger joined AFLAC in 1992 as a senior vice president and chief financial officer. He became president in 2001, retaining the title of CFO. Since joining AFLAC, his primary responsibilities have included financial management of all company operations in the United States and Japan.

Cloninger also plays a key role in developing strategic and operational plans for AFLAC, including the company's yen-debt financing program, the share repurchase program, capital hedging strategy and profit repatriation strategy, among others.

Cloninger also serves on the boards of directors for AFLAC Inc. and Tupperware Corporation.
